Kashmere Multi-service Center


Kashmere Multi-Service Center is a renovation of an existing facility at 4802 Lockwood in the Kashmere Gardens neighborhood. The facility is open 8 a.m. to 5 p.m. Monday through Friday and provides services to the neighborhood including day care, services for seniors, a YMCA, parenting education and health education programs. Examples of recent offerings include a free kidney screening for individuals at risk of developing kidney disease and a “Will-a-thon” to help seniors 60 and older write a will. There is also a day-care program with 26 children currently enrolled. The center is well used by the neighborhood and clients will benefit from art in their service facility.

Artist Opportunity
Civic art is important for this site and has the opportunity to be fully integrated into the building due to inclusion of the artist during reconstruction. There are two sites for art at Kashmere. The first is a 15’ wall inside the building behind the reception desk. The second location is an exterior wall at the building entrance.

Prospectus for Commissioning Artworks for the Health and Human Services Department of the City of Houston
The City of Houston Department of Health and Human Services and the Houston Arts Alliance are seeking artists to provide artwork at two multi-service centers: Northeast and Kashmere.

The artwork(s) should: Create excitement and interest for the community; Augment activities at the Center and Celebrate the impact the Center has on the community

The artwork must be durable, low maintenance, and appropriate to the location. Artists should take into consideration the high amount of pedestrian traffic within the center, light sources (both natural and electric), and temperature control when designing the artwork.

Works in a variety of media and forms will be considered. Examples of media include but are not limited to: textiles, paint, wood, metal, and photography. Although the City of Houston and HAA do not endorse restrictions on artistic content, the Artist Selection Panel will consider the building’s users in making their selection.

Budget
Kashmere Multi-Service Center $47,000 all inclusive

The budget covers all costs associated with the project including but not limited to: artist’s design fee, travel, materials, fabrication costs, liability insurance, documentation, and transportation and installation of the work.
